What are Repulpable Light Blue Butterfly Die-Cuts?

 
Repulpable light blue butterfly die-cuts — commonly called paster tabs or butterfly tabs in the paper and printing industry — are pre-cut, single-sided adhesive labels/tabs used in the preparation of paper reels for flying splice operations. They are a component of the splice preparation process, not the splice tape itself: while the double-sided splicing tape joins the new reel to the running web at the moment of splice, the butterfly tab holds the top layer of the new reel flat and secure against the reel body during the run-up phase, preventing it from lifting and flapping before the splice is triggered.

Pioneer's butterfly die-cuts are constructed from a printable white kraft paper carrier (coated in light blue for identification, keeping it consistent with the light blue colour convention used across Pioneer's repulpable paper mill tape range), coated with synthetic resin water-soluble adhesive on one face, and protected by a silicone-coated white paper liner. The butterfly shape is specifically engineered and recommended for securing the top layer of paper with the 'TUB' profile — the reel preparation format used on offline coaters and super calenders — where the wings of the butterfly shape provide controlled adhesion points that hold the top layer flat without restricting the clean separation of the tab at the moment of splice.

The single-sided configuration is deliberate and functional: the tab bonds on one face to the paper reel's top layer, while the uncoated carrier face can be used for identification marking, batch coding, or operator notes if required — the printable white kraft paper construction enables this. Applications of Repulpable Light Blue Butterfly Die-Cuts

 
Flying Splice Preparation — Top Layer Securing on Offline Coaters

The primary confirmed application is securing the top layer of medium and heavy weight paper reels during the run-up to flying splices on offline coating plants. In a flying splice on an offline coater, the new reel is brought up to running speed while the expiring reel is still feeding the web. The top layer of the new reel must be held absolutely flat and secure during this acceleration phase — any lifting or flapping of the top layer creates a mis-splice when the splice tape makes contact.

The butterfly tab is applied during splice preparation as follows:
• Step 1 — Reel preparation: The splicing tape is applied to the new reel in the TUB profile configuration, ready for the splice. The top layer of paper is folded back to expose the splicing tape and then returned to its flat position over the reel.
• Step 2 — Tab application: The butterfly die-cut liner is peeled and the tab is applied across the top layer in the position specified for the TUB profile, with the butterfly wings providing adhesion points that hold the top layer flat against the reel.
• Step 3 — Run-up: The new reel is accelerated to match the running web speed. The butterfly tab holds the top layer flat through the full run-up phase, preventing flapping under the aerodynamic forces of the accelerating web.
• Step 4 — Splice and separation: At the moment of splice, the splicing tape bonds the new reel to the running web. The butterfly tab separates cleanly from the reel as the splice completes, and the tab is carried into the web — where it will eventually enter the pulping process and disperse without contaminating the fibre.

Medium & Heavy Weight Paper Reel Changes

The tabs are confirmed as particularly suitable for securing the top layer of medium and heavy weight paper reels. On heavier paper grades, the aerodynamic forces on the top layer during run-up are greater — making the high bonding strength of the butterfly tab more critical than for lighter paper grades where the top layer is less susceptible to lifting.

The TUB profile is the specific reel end preparation format used on offline coaters and super calenders, where the paper top layer is folded back to expose the splicing tape and then returned to a flat position over the reel end ready for the splice. The butterfly shape is specifically recommended for securing the top layer in this TUB configuration — the wing geometry of the butterfly provides adhesion contact points at the correct positions on the top layer to hold it flat and secure through the run-up phase without creating excessive adhesion that would prevent clean separation at the moment of splice.
The butterfly die-cut tab and the splicing tape perform different functions in the same flying splice process. The splicing tape (double-sided) is the component that actually joins the new reel to the running web — it is the adhesive bond that creates the splice. The butterfly tab is a preparation component that secures the top layer of the new reel flat against the reel body during the run-up phase before the splice happens. Both components are used together in the same splice preparation process: the splicing tape creates the splice, the butterfly tab prevents the failure mode that stops the splice from working correctly.
Single-sided adhesive is correct for this application because the tab only needs to bond on one face — to the top layer of the paper reel — to perform its top layer securing function. If the tab were double-sided, the second adhesive face would create an unwanted bond between the top layer and the reel body underneath it, which would prevent the top layer from releasing cleanly at the moment of splice. The single-sided construction bonds the tab to the top layer only, holding it flat against the reel while leaving the interface between the top layer and the reel body free to separate as the splice occurs.
